    Sonic Mania feature collectable medals - 32 locked behind special stages in which the player needs to collect blue spheres. While enticing for completionists to complete, the blue spheres are trial-and-error stages that rarely bring enjoyment when attempting them. Sonic's speed directly affects the ease of controlling him in these special stages, making tight corners and small jumps more difficult than they should be. You may think that retrying these special stages is the feasible option, but they only return after the special stage rotation has completed; that is, there is no way of practicing or preparing for an entirely new special stage in which you have one chance to collect all blue spheres without messing up. Nonetheless, the music of these special stages make playing them bearable, and nothing is more satisfying than completing them with perfection.

That’s another positive of this game- the obvious variety in characters without any strange new ones being added. All of them go to the same levels, except for Knuckles who has a few differences in his campaign. You can play as the titular blue hedgehog, the flying fox Tails, and the superpowered enchillada Knuckles. You’re also able to play as both Sonic and Tails. They all have different abilities, mainly that their way of upwards mobility varies. Sonic can use the power up shields in different ways from the other two by pressing the “A” button in midair (for example if you use the bubble shield power up you can tap A twice to get an extra high bounce), Tails can just straight up fly, and knuckles can glide and climb up walls. I like this, because it can provide you with various levels of difficulty. Tails is the easiest to play as once you get the hang of his controls, Knuckles is slightly harder but still has some of his own areas designed around his abilities and can get up to high areas with ease, and Sonic is the most pure and simple way to play the game.
